Things you should know about Australia

Australia is a world-famous country for its natural wonders and wide-open spaces which include its beaches and deserts the bush, and the Outback.


Australia is one among the world's most highly urbanized countries; it's documented for the attractions of its large cities like Sydney, Melbourne, Brisbane, and Perth

Australia is the sixth-largest country by land area. Australia is bordered to the west by the Indian Ocean, and to the east by the South Pacific Ocean. The Tasman Sea lies to the southeast which separates it from New Zealand while the Coral Sea lies to the northeast. Papua New Guinea , East Timor and Indonesia are Australia's northern neighbors, separated from Australia by the Arafura Sea and therefore the Timor Sea .


Australia is famous for its Australia tour and is highly urbanized with most of the population heavily concentrated along the eastern and south-eastern coasts. Most of the inland areas are semi-arid. The most-populous states are Victoria and New South Wales, but far and away the most important in acreage is Western Australia .

As an outsized island, a good variety of climates is found across Australia. It is not completely hot and sun-kissed, as stereotypes would suggest. There are regions that can be quite cool and wet. The north is hot and tropical as compared to the south tends to be sub-tropical and temperate. Most rainfall is around the coast, and far from the Centre is arid and semi-arid. The daytime maximum temperatures rarely drop below 30°C even in winter while night temperatures in winter usually drop around 15 degrees Celsius. Temperatures in some southern regions can drop below freezing in winter and therefore the Snowy Mountains within the South East experience’s meters of winter snow.
